Moron of the week

Posted on 04:08 by Unknown
I have a looter pilot, Kelly. Her job is to salvage and loot the destroyed ships, miners and catalysts alike. While this activity can make her go suspect, her security status is not negative and she isn't in a wardeccable corporation. There aren't any kill rights against her, so the only way to kill her is to catch her while being a suspect - or suicide gank.

tk1n, a brave white knight with an insightful name was camping the station trying to catch my ganker pilots undocking. He didn't have any luck, probably never heard of insta undock and insta-dock bookmarks. Meanwhile I've found a target and first undocked Kelly so her fat cruiser get far enough from the station to avoid bumping into it. I was busy fitting my ganker when I heard combat sounds. Switched back to Kelly and found that the brave knight attacked her instead of the gankers. CONCORD handled his ship and I got a kill right:

Dumb! - I thought and carried on with the gank preparation. Undocked and saw his flashy red pod sitting at the undock, 2000 meters from my Catalyst. Locked and popped it, then warped to the insta-undock and killed the miner a minute later. After redocking and looting the miner I checked his pod. 640M.

I don't know which was dumber: going to PvP with that pod? Having safety on red without the clear intention to suicide gank? Not warping out his pod after losing his ship? I leave the decision to the readers, but his moron status cannot be disputed.


My miner guide page was updated with a chart showing how many T2 or lowbie Catalys needed to destroy various mining ships:
"Yield" fit means T2 miners in highs, mining upgrades in lows and tanking modules in mids and rigs. "Tanked" means also Damage Control module in one of the lows. "Idiot" means not even tanking modules in mids and rigs.
